I needed to run Selenium on macOS chrome driver python mac for the first time today. You need to first install Python from chrome driver python mac here. Never fear, here is a better way: Installing on macOS:. You can also read Getting Started with Android or Getting Started with ChromeOS. 6 has pip chrome driver python mac available in the standard library.
WebDriverException: Message: ‘geckodriver’ executable needs to be in PATH. I won&39;t. Through Selenium Python API you can access all functionalities mac of Selenium WebDriver in an intuitive way. py chrome driver python mac and compile using the following chrome driver python mac command. · When the installation is done, we can check the version of chrome driver by running the following command on the terminal: chromedriver --version. Selenium Python bindings provide a convenient API to access Selenium WebDrivers like Firefox, Ie, Chrome, Remote etc.
We need to download the chromedriver executable file from t. this package chrome driver python mac is maintained by an automated update script on travis. See full list on medium. Verify the version of the chrome driver python mac Chrome driver, by running the command −. The current supported Python versions are 2. Note– In this blog, we use the Windows Environment, Python version 3. Now you have to copy the driver in /usr/local/bin and that all. Selenium ChromeDriver&Pythonでブラウザを起動しようとしているのですが、アドレスバーに”data:,”と表示され、ブラウザには指定したサイトが表示されず困っています。 動作 コマンドを実行（python3 xxxxx.
Chrome () driver = webdriver. To get started, you have to create an account on LambdaTest. py） ブラウザ起動. Getting the best out of ‘parallel testing’ is important for the implementation of Continuous Integration chrome driver python mac (CI). 6 and Eclipse as Selenium IDE 1. This approach chrome driver python mac is not only expensive but it is also non-scalable. Unlike other courses this course covers Python Scripting from scratch so chrome driver python mac even if you don’t know anything about Python scripting you can take this course. Install the Chrome driver with the homebrew by running the command − brew cask install chromedriver.
Chrome() のところでエラーが出てしまいました。考えらる原因はなんでしょうか？よろしくお願いします。! Now that you have understood the advantages of using Selenium with Python for automation testing, we explain the basic steps for installation & configuration. ChromeDriver is a separate executable that Selenium WebDriver uses to control Chrome. You can save the file as search. Import the selenium.
The official home of the Python Programming Language. Links to some of the more popular browser drivers follow. Python Programming Language is the fastest growing programming language within both the fields, development and testing. Selenium requires a driver to interface with the chosen browser. You still need to run it once in the terminal. In this post, we’ll mainly discuss the following subjects so that you get acquainted with Selenium Webdriver Library for Python:.
To use Python Selenium bindings, you need to install Python language and Python Selenium bindings. Please protect ports used by ChromeDriver and related test frameworks to prevent access chrome driver python mac by malicious code. Is chromedriver open source? Here is one of the Best-selling courses chrome driver python mac on Udemy to learn Python scripting from scratch and to learn Web Application Test Automation using Selenium WebDriver and Python. Ensure that your PATH is appended with the location where Python executable is located. In this video, I am installing ChromeDriver which we will need to run tests on the Chrome browser. Firefox, for example, chrome driver python mac requires geckodriver, chrome driver python mac which needs to be installed before the below examples can be run.
Now that you have the setup ready, you can now use Selenium WebDriver Python Bindings for testing of your web application. We can now go ahead and create a python script that utilizes it. I’ll go into details about the ChromeDriver, starting from download, installation and to use it on Windows and Mac. How do I install chromedriver chrome driver python mac on my Mac?
While using Selenium WebDriver with Python for automation testing through your source code, you might land in a situation where you cannot verify the web application on the local infrastructure (or setup) that is currently available e. chrome driver python mac Your requirement is to test your web app with Firefox browser (version 64. ChromeDriver is available for Chrome on Android.
If there are less number of tests, you might not require parallel testing in Selenium WebDriver for Python or any other language, but once the complexity of the project increases (or chrome driver python mac number of tests to be executed increase), parallel testing is the ideal mechanism to achieve the best results in the minimum chrome driver python mac possible time. Selenium Python bindings provides a simple API to write functional/acceptance tests using Selenium WebDriver. chrome driver python mac if python a new chromedriver version is out, this package will automaticly get updated within a day. Mac OS Xでpython 2. More Chromedriver Python Mac images. 17 hours ago Chropath extension doesnot comes in this webpage 1 day ago; Chropath gets disappeared even after pinning in the browser 1 day ago.
Other supported browsers will have their own drivers available. In chrome driver python mac this example, we have introduced a ‘Blocking Wait’ call of 30 seconds only for demonstration purpose. WebDriver is an open source tool for automated testing of webapps across many browsers.
ec04b6e38e22703e856e101e840b65afe72) on port 9515 Only local connections are allowed. Before we start automating our test script with Microsoft Edge browser using Selenium, we need to make sure that, We should have Windows-10 installed in our machine. Remote (browser_name="iphone", 36:3001/hub&39;) driver = webdriver.
Then, install Python’s selenium package into our environment: $ pipenv install selenium --dev. setProperty line of your code. . get org&39;) You can change the browser by creating a different instance: driver = webdriver. 27 for automated testing of webapps. the installer supports linux, mac and windows operating systems.
Chrome(): chrome driver python mac chromedriver = "/path/to/chromedriver/folder"driver = webdriver. What is chromedriver for Android? downloads and installs the latest chromedriver binary version for automated testing of webapps.
6でseleniumとchromdriverを使ってログイン処理を実装したく、次のページを参考に実装を進めています。 類似のエラーに関するページをいくつか拝見し、webdriver. py (Note – In case you are using an IDE like Eclipse, you can compile & execute your code using the PLAY button in the Eclipse IDE). In any case, the WebDriver will wait until the page loads completely, after which the control returns back to the script. See full list on lambdatest. Open the Home Page.
Download link 23/ Second step- In MAC we have one directory called /usr/local/ In above location, you can create bin folder (if not created). If Python is installed in the location C:&92;&92;Users&92;&92;&92;&92;appdata&92;&92;local&92;&92;programs&92;&92;python&92;&92;Python36; you need to append the folder location to the environme. zip if chrome driver python mac you&39;re on 64bit Windows. chrome driver python mac For example with the Homebrew package manager and your terminal window: Install mac ChromeDriver with brew cask install chromedriver. Windows, Linux, Macintosh. · Python selenium bindings provides a simple API to write functional/acceptance tests using Selenium WebDriver. Microsoft Edge Legacy Microsoft WebDriver for Microsoft Edge Legacy versions is a Windows Feature on Demand which ensures that it’s always up to date automatically and enables some new ways to get Microsoft WebDriver. By leveraging cloud based, cross browser testing tools such as LambdaTest, you can verify your web app for cross browser compatibility across + different browsers, OS, resolutions, devices, etc.
You have to generate the necessary capabilities i. · chromedriver-binary. The Selenium framework can be used with a wide range of programming languages such as Python, Java, C, and more.
Latest Python chrome driver python mac 3 Release mac - Python 3. Resolved issue 3462: For sendKeys, CMD key don&39;t work for MAC Resolved issue 3541: Improve log between Client and ChromeDriver Resolved issue 3559: Output Chrome version when ChromeDriver reports incompatible. setHttpProxy ("myhttpproxy:3337"); options. homebrewからchromedriverをインストールし、下のようにコードを書いたのですが、browser = webdriver. Let’s do a code walkthrough and have a look at python some of the critical parts in the above example for Selenium Webdriver for Python automation testing. You can view the current implementation status of the WebDriver standard here. (The PATH variable helps Chrome find the downloaded ChromeDriver exe). .
You probably need to check if the location of the chromedriver. If it&39;s in C drive then, System. It has powerful features (like Timeline, Automati. 0) installed on a Windows 10 machine.
exe and mention the correct path to it in the system. The installer supports Linux, MacOS and Windows operating systems. Selenium WebDriver Automation; Why Python Programming Language? Proxy proxy = new Proxy (); proxy. · Select geckodriver-vx.
You either have to provide a path to binary when creating an instance of webdrive. webDriver module that provides the WebDriver implementation. , place it in /usr/bin or /usr/local/bin. In such a process, you would require the required setup with the same version of Firefox installed on it. Nowadays, more teams are focused on making use of Continuous Integration (CI) and Continuous Delivery (CD)in the overall chrome driver python mac software development & testing process. · Understanding cross-browser testing automation using Selenium WebDriver with a complete scenario python Assuming in real time, you start writing the code in your User Interface (consider Eclipse IDE) with the help of any of the client libraries supported by Selenium (say Python). Listed in order of easiest to hardest install, these are the best ways chrome driver python mac to install ChromeDriver on a Mac: The easiest way to install ChromeDriver is to use your package manager such as brew (or npm) to python install the driver. · We shall take the help of Homebrew package manager for installation in Mac OS.
gz if your environment is Mac, or geckodriver-vx. ChromeDriver is a standalone server that implements the W3C WebDriver standard. After downloading, you can put the contents of chrome driver python mac the unzipped zip file through the PATH environment variable. At the time of writing, the latest version of chromedriver installed by homebrew is version 73.